Get answers to common questions about Complete Shellac Mani & Pedi Package.
Most clients enjoy two weeks or more of flawless wear; fingernails typically last up to 14–21 days, toenails often 14 days or longer. Wear depends on nail growth and activity — proper aftercare and gentle handling extend the Shellac’s life.
Yes. When applied and removed properly by trained technicians, Shellac is safe. We use gentle prep and soak-off removal methods, plus nourishing treatments to minimize damage. Give nails short breaks between heavy applications if you notice thinning or sensitivity.
Absolutely. We offer an extensive Shellac color library and can custom mix shades for a perfect match. Bring a fabric swatch or photo and our technicians will help you choose complementary tones and finishes to achieve the exact look you want.
The full service typically takes 75–105 minutes depending on nail condition and added treatments. Time includes shaping, cuticle work, moisturizing, and UV curing for both hands and feet. Arrive early if you need additional nail art or special requests.
We recommend having Shellac removed professionally to avoid peeling or damage. At-home removal is possible with proper acetone soak-off technique, careful filing, and cuticle care, but improper removal increases risk of thinning and splitting of the natural nail.
Avoid prolonged soaking in hot water for the first 24 hours and use gloves for household chores. Apply cuticle oil daily and avoid picking at edges. Schedule timely fills or removal to maintain nail health and a polished appearance.
